His attacks are the same from Mega Man 3. Shadow Man is one of the first four bosses available. He attacks by jumping, throwing Shadow Blades, and sliding. Shadow Man is one of the eight stage bosses. Shadow Man loves sneaking up on others by using his ninja abilities and has come to dislike obvious and boring tricks. Shadow Man, being a ninja, has amazing flexibility, but has been known to be rather impulsive and has a shallow way of thinking. Shadow Man is a skilled martial artist and a master of ninjutsu magic - his abilities include being able to temporarily create duplicates of himself to distract or attack his foes, create smoke screens, and summon frog robots of varying sizes - including a giant frog robot to ride on or smaller ones to check areas for him. Shadow Man can also use the Kawarimi no Jutsu, a ninja technique that replaces the body of the user with an object, usually a piece of log, as defense in his battle in Mega Man 2: The Power Fighters and Super Adventure Rockman, as well as when he loses a race in Mega Man: Battle & Chase. Shadow Man's Special Weapon is the Shadow Blade, a large hira shuriken coated with a deadly substance capable of deranging the function of robotic mechanisms.
